Understanding Costs and Requirements
The financial implications of pursuing an F1 visa, even with the eventual goal of working in Germany, are significant. Costs include SEVIS fees, visa application fees, and the substantial expense of tuition and living costs in the US for the duration of study. For a Kenyan nurse, budgeting these expenses in Kenya Shillings (KES) is essential. While exact figures vary greatly, initial application and government fees might range from KES 40,000 to KES 60,000. Tuition and living expenses can easily run into millions of KES per year. Thorough financial planning and potentially seeking scholarships or financial aid are vital components of this journey.
